Waitrose is testing an innovative delivery service that allows its drivers to enter homes with keyless Yale smart lock technology. The service is currently being trialled in Coulsdon south London. The service will allow delivery drivers to store refrigerated and frozen items however other items can be put on kitchen counters. The entire process will be recorded by an attached camera to the driver's chest.

The premium supermarket chain is attempting to regain its share of the UK grocery market, which has fallen from 5.1pc to 4.6pc since the start of 2021. The share has dipped further in the wake of numerous prominent initiatives from rivals such as Tesco, Sainsbury's, and Morrisons that have gained ground over discounters Lidl and Aldi.

The luxurious British retailer has had to contend with an increase in competition from discount chains like Lidl and Aldi that have been increasing their market share. Nevertheless, Waitrose still ranks first in a recent study conducted by Market Force Information on customer perceptions of seven supermarket chains. The survey was conducted with 4,300 people who rated supermarkets on assortment, layout, and cleanliness.
